Abstract

A kind of no fragmentation formula highly effective and safe fire extinguisher bomb, including broken first portion, extinguishing chemical spout part, power section, frizzen and insurance part.It is cellular that no fragmentation formula, which is embodied in extinguishing chemical spout part, and all extinguishing chemicals are burst film and come out by equally distributed small hole injection on shell under high pressure gas effect after internal explosive is lighted, this process middle casing will not fragmentation, do not generate any fragmentation.It is efficiently embodied on extinguishing chemical, the extinguishing chemical used in the present invention is ultra-fine dry powder extinguishing agent, and fire extinguishing rate is 40 times or more of water system row extinguishing chemical, and fire-fighting efficiency is 6 ~ 10 times of common dry powder fire extinguishing agent.So the extinguishing chemical used in the present invention can reach maximum extinguishing effect within the shortest time.Safety is embodied in fire extinguisher bomb with night bolt and insurance sucker, and only when both being pulled out, fire extinguisher bomb could fire and spray fire extinguishing agent, double insurance effectively increase the safety coefficient of fire extinguisher bomb.

Background technology
With the fast development of economic technology, more and more high buildings are rised sheer from level ground, and high-rise, high-rise building everywhere may be used See, and concurrently a new problem occurs --- high-rise, high-rise building fire rescue.
Traditional fire fighting truck that urban fire control is equipped at present is by certain height limitation, as high-rise, high-rise building is more next More, traditional fire fighting truck can not preferably be suitable for high-rise, high-rise building fire extinguishing, so fire extinguisher bomb is just sent out step by step Transform into the first-selected instrument for high-rise high-rise building fire extinguishing.
At 2009 16 days 19 or so, factory of Jiutai City porter Chen is toward fire extinguisher bomb is carried in warehouse, suddenly It loses one's footing and falls down, a sound of " banging ", the fire extinguisher bomb in case lands after-explosion, he feels one black at the moment immediately, is painfully poured on On the ground, fellow worker hears the news come after immediately Chen be sent to hospital give treatment to;Through looking into, Chen's eyes be explosion injury, left eye hematocele, Cornea and scleral rupture, right eyelid laceration of skin;It can be seen that safety is particularly important in the storage of fire extinguisher bomb and transportational process.
There are many miscellaneous fire extinguisher bombs in fire extinguisher bomb field at present, and extinguishing chemical is also complicated various, mainly have hot aerosol, Carbon dioxide, heptafluoro-propane, Kazakhstan dragon 1301, water mists, ABC dry powder and ultra-fine dry powder etc..In numerous extinguishing chemicals, titanium dioxide Carbon, heptafluoro-propane breathe out dragon 1301, water mists condition of storage as high pressure, and hot aerosol is normal pressure, and ABC dry powder is low pressure, ultra-fine dry Powder is low pressure or normal pressure.Wherein ultra-fine dry powder extinguishing agent can not only be put out a fire with total flooding application, but also can be put out a fire with localised protection application, Its rate of putting out a fire is 40 times or more of water system row extinguishing chemical, and fire-fighting efficiency is 2 ~ 3 times of halon fire agent, is common dry-chemical fire extinguishing 6 ~ 10 times of agent.

Invention content
As gradually popularizing for fire extinguisher bomb uses, the safety and extinguishing effect of fire extinguisher bomb become the most important thing of its design, In order to solve current fire extinguisher bomb in use fragmentation hurt sb.'s feelings and store and transportational process in unstability caused by pacify Full hidden danger.The present invention proposes a kind of no fragmentation formula highly effective and safe fire extinguisher bomb, has fully ensured that the safety and fire extinguishing effect of fire extinguisher bomb Fruit.
To realize that, without fragmentation, efficient, safety, the technical solution adopted by the present invention is:A kind of no fragmentation formula highly effective and safe goes out Fiery bullet, including fire extinguisher bomb break first portion, fire extinguisher bomb power section, frizzen, delay ignitor device, extinguishing chemical spout part and insurance Part.
Fire extinguisher bomb breaks first portion and is located at fire extinguisher bomb front end, is connected with extinguishing chemical spout part by frizzen, breaks first portion tool There is higher intensity, being mainly used to brokenly window in use makes fire extinguisher bomb enter, while broken first portion is impacted and drives frizzen It pushes backward, and then delay ignitor device is made to generate high-voltage spark.
Fire extinguisher bomb internal delay time igniter generates high-tension current during frizzen is toward pusher, and high-tension current passes through It explosive is transmitted to by conducting wire after time-delay mechanism extension 0.2s generates electric spark and ignite explosive.
Fire extinguisher bomb power section is located at fire extinguisher bomb rear end, and power source makes inside for the striker impact fire extinguisher bomb bottom fire in a stove before fuel is added The high pressure gas that gunpowder explosion generates, high pressure gas is by fire extinguisher bomb other parts and fire extinguisher bomb power section quick separating.
Extinguishing chemical spout part is located at middle part, and breaking first portion with front end by frizzen is connected, and passes through nested and fire extinguishing springing Power part is connected, and shell is cellular, is uniform-distribution with the aperture of diameter 1.6mm thereon, and outer casing inner wall is one layer thin Film, spout part internal core are explosive, are extinguishing chemical between explosive and film.
The extinguishing chemical that the present invention uses is the extinguishing chemical based on ultra-fine dry powder, when explosive receives what conducting wire was transmitted through High-tension current and generate rapid explosive expansions when electric spark, the high pressure gas of generation squeezes extinguishing chemical and bursts film, and extinguishing chemical exists High pressure gas effect is lower to be sprayed by aperture.
Fire extinguisher bomb insurance part is made of insurance sucker and night bolt.Insurance sucker is located at the fire extinguisher bomb power section fire in a stove before fuel is added Place, when use, which pulls out sucker, can just be such that the fire in a stove before fuel is added is hit, so make internal gunpowder explosion generate high pressure gas by fire extinguisher bomb its He partly with fire extinguisher bomb power section quick separating;Night bolt is located at connection and breaks on the frizzen of first portion and foamite container, Fuse is extracted when use, bolt is fallen, and frizzen is free, and can light a fire the explosive that ignites when broken first portion is impacted, and will go out Fiery agent ejects;It can not work if without pulling out insurance sucker and fuse fire extinguisher bomb.
Present invention design is mainly used for high-rise, high-rise building fire extinguishing, and can be used for forest, traffic accident accident etc., other are led The fire extinguishing in domain, it is special according to using distance that fire extinguisher bomb is divided into following several models because of the uncertainty of service condition:100m, 150m, 200m;The fire extinguisher bomb of three kinds of different models only needs the explosive payload for quantitatively changing power section can be realized.
Beneficial effects of the present invention:The present invention is a kind of no fragmentation formula highly effective and safe fire extinguisher bomb, by extinguishing chemical spout part It has been designed to cellular, has not generated any fragment in work process;Secondly the extinguishing chemical of the present invention is ultra-fine dry powder, fire extinguishing Rate is 40 times or more of water system row extinguishing chemical, fire-fighting efficiency is 2 ~ 3 times of halon fire agent, be common dry powder fire extinguishing agent 6 ~ 10 times, maximum extinguishing effect can be reached within the shortest time;Have again and fire extinguisher bomb be divided into Multiple Type, it is ensured that Best extinguishing effect in each distance segment and safety;Finally present invention employs dual fail-safe design, i.e., night bolt and Insure sucker, only fire extinguisher bomb can just work normally when both being pulled out, and avoid because of human error operation etc. It causes casualties, greatly improves the safety coefficient of fire extinguisher bomb.

Specific implementation mode
A kind of no fragmentation formula highly effective and safe fire extinguisher bomb of the present invention, is mainly reflected in no fragmentation, efficiently, safely and goes out Four aspects of fire;The present invention is described further below in conjunction with the accompanying drawings:Fire extinguisher bomb of the present invention includes fire extinguishing springing Power part 1, extinguishing chemical spout part 2, broken first portion 3, frizzen 4, night bolt 5, delay ignitor device 6, conducting wire 7, inside are quick-fried Fried object 8, fuse 11 and insurance sucker 12.
The broken first portion(3)Positioned at fire extinguisher bomb front end, pass through frizzen(4)With extinguishing chemical spout part(2)It is connected. Broken first portion shape is oval taper, is conducive to reduce resistance during advancing, is made of steel alloy material, there are a slots at middle part It is fixed with frizzen, broken first portion is mainly used for the broken window of fire extinguisher bomb, ensures that fire extinguishing resilience energy smoothly reaches at target burning things which may cause a fire disaster, breaks first portion It is impacted and drives frizzen to pusher, and then delay ignitor device is made to generate high-tension current.
Extinguishing chemical spout part(2)To be cellular, shell is made of aluminium alloy or other high rigidity lightweight materials, nested In extinguishing chemical power section(1), it has circumferentially been uniformly distributed the circular hole of a diameter of 1.6mm, inner walls have thin film, ejection section It is explosive to divide internal core, and the ultra-fine dry powder as extinguishing chemical is filled between explosive and film, and spout part front end has One delay ignitor device(6), delay ignitor device generates high-tension current under the promotion of frizzen, and high-tension current result is delayed 0.2s is transmitted to internal explosion object by conducting wire(8)Simultaneously electric spark being generated to ignite explosive, explosive generates rapidly high pressure gas, Extinguishing chemical bursts film under high pressure gas effect, and then extinguishing chemical passes through small hole injection countless on shell.Inside fire extinguisher bomb Explosive main purpose is to eject extinguishing chemical to generate high pressure gas rapidly;Internal explosion object can be gunpowder or mix Gas is closed, which can explode rapidly when encountering electric spark, generate high pressure gas.Since spout part shell has very greatly Intensity thus internal explosive explode generate high pressure gas during shell not will crack, so be not present fragmentation, and And the ultra-fine dry powder extinguishing agent of injection can promptly control fire behavior.
Fire extinguisher bomb power section(1)Positioned at fire extinguisher bomb rear end, for promoting fire extinguisher bomb other parts.Fire extinguisher bomb power section Shell is steel alloy material, and the fire in a stove before fuel is added is arranged at bottom, has an insurance sucker at the fire in a stove before fuel is added, is gunpowder inside shell, in order to realize fire extinguisher bomb A variety of distance effects, different according to the explosive payload of gunpowder, fire extinguisher bomb can be divided into three classes, correspond to respectively range 100m, 150m, 200m;When the fire in a stove before fuel is added is hit, gunpowder is ignited, and gunpowder moment generates high pressure gas and is separately from other sections nested.
Insurance part is by night bolt(5)With insurance sucker(12)Composition.Night bolt(5)Pass through fuse holder pin hole(9) Across frizzen, across fuse hole(10)Fuse(11)Restriction effect under stay put, when use, pulls out insurance Silk, night bolt are fallen, and frizzen is free at this time, can be lighted a fire under the promotion in broken first portion.Insure sucker(12)It is located at At the fire extinguisher bomb power section fire in a stove before fuel is added, fire extinguisher bomb has only pulled out the insurance sucker fire in a stove before fuel is added and can just be impacted, but also to pull out insurance Extinguishing chemical spout part can just spray when silk, and double insurance ensure that fire extinguisher bomb is storing and the safety in transportational process.
